Overview

The STM32H730VBT6 is a high-performance 32-bit microcontroller powered by the Arm Cortex-M7 core running at speeds up to 550 MHz. This device features 128 KB of Flash memory and 564 KB of RAM, bridging the gap between traditional MCUs and application processors for intensive real-time tasks. It includes specialized hardware like the Chrom-ART Accelerator and an LCD-TFT controller to handle demanding graphical and data-processing workloads.

Why Choose This Part

This MCU offers an exceptional performance-to-power ratio with its integrated SMPS and 550 MHz core frequency. It provides advanced reliability through ECC on both Flash and SRAM, while its diverse connectivity suite including Octo-SPI and SDIO allows for flexible external memory expansion despite the limited 128 KB internal Flash.

Applications

High-Resolution HMI Systems
Utilizes the integrated LCD-TFT controller and Chrom-ART Accelerator to drive graphical user interfaces with minimal CPU overhead.
Edge AI and Signal Processing
Leverages the 550 MHz clock speed, FPU, and DSP instructions for real-time sensor fusion and local machine learning inference.
Industrial Networking Gateways
Manages complex protocol bridging using dual CAN FD, Ethernet, and high-speed USB OTG interfaces.
Digital Audio Workstations
Employs SAI, I2S, and SPDIF interfaces along with digital filters for high-fidelity audio processing and routing.

Getting Started

Start development using the STM32CubeH7 software suite and the STM32CubeIDE for full debugging support. For hardware prototyping, look for the NUCLEO-H723ZG or specialized STM32H7 Discovery kits to evaluate the Cortex-M7 performance and high-speed peripherals. Ensure the SMPS power circuitry is correctly configured in your hardware design to achieve the specified 81 mA typical run current.
